Craig Goldy is the guitarist who passed through Dio most often, joining the band in separate periods between 1986 and 2010. Born in 1961, he came in replacing Vivian Campbell and debuted on Dream Evil (1987). His relationship with Ronnie James Dio was the closest of all the group's guitarists, and that is why he was called back so many times. He returned in the late 1990s and wrote much of the material of the band's final phase — Magica (2000), Killing the Dragon (2002) and Master of the Moon (2004) — a period in which Dio regained consistency after a decade of unstable line-ups. His style is melodic with clean phrasing, closer to 1980s hard rock than to technical metal, and it serves well a repertoire in which the guitar exists to support the voice and make room for it. He was in the band until Dio's death in 2010.
